On Saturday August 16, 2014 Buffalo Rising co-sponsored the second Cirque du Square at Niagara Square (photos below).
The day-long event is a practice in place-making. We’re going to be turning the square (in front of City Hall) into a social setting from 11am to 5pm, where people can listen to live music, play lawn games, sit out at café-style seating with market umbrellas, while enjoying pressed juices and rice bowls (Ashker’s), coffee and espresso (Public Espresso), and treats by Sweet Melody’s (gelato).
Buffalo’s Kubb players will be setting up (see here), along with j-WAY Games for the kids (see here), and BlueCross BlueShield will be on-hand with their Health Zone Cruiser (more cool kids activities).
There will be demonstrations by a number of special guests that intend to add interesting aspects to our central square at the heart of the city. This is not an event per se. Rather it is an attempt to activate a setting in Downtown Buffalo, so that people can come down and enjoy the city as it was intended to be – a social gathering place.
This is the second time that we are running this free outdoor affair. We intend to show visitors what is possible – the sights and sounds and flavors of a true urban square.
